  • ECC clears circular debt plan, paves way to wind up Power Holding Limited
    Dawn - 04:00 Nov 08, 2025
    • Okays Rs960bn sovereign guarantee for Rs1.225tr loans from local banks • Says remittance incentives to be phased out with caution • Gas allocated to fertiliser sector; LNG cost adjustments cleared for tariffs ISLAMABAD: The Econo­mic Coordination Committee (ECC) of the Cabinet on Fri­day approved an inter-corporate circular debt settlement plan, including tariff rationalisation for all six operational nuclear power plants in line with other power producers, thus also paving the way to wind up Power Holding Ltd (PHL), a shell company created to park old circular debt. The meeting of the ECC, pre­­sided over by Finance Mi­­nister Muhammad Aurangzeb, also approved about Rs660 billion in sovereign guarantees for Rs1.225 trillion in commercial loans from local banks for circular debt settlement and the diversion of gas for fertiliser plants.   • US accuses Iran of ‘plotting to kill’ Israeli ambassador
    Dawn - 03:40 Nov 08, 2025
    WASHINGTON: The United States accused Iran on Friday of “plotting to assassinate” Israel’s ambassador to Mexico, in what would be the latest attempt to take the two countries’ conflict to another region. A US official said the Revolutionary Guards’ elite Quds Force initiated the plot late last year and that it was disrupted this year. “The plot was contained and does not pose a current threat,” the US official said. The US official did not provide detailed evidence or say how the plot was contained. The Iranian mission to the United Nations declined to comment. According to the US official, the alleged plot would have taken place after April 1 last year, when Israel attacked the Iranian embassy complex in Damascus, killing several top officers of the Revolutionary Guards. Israel carried out a much more extensive bombing campaign in Iran this year that killed more than 1,000 people. The United States joined by bombing key nuclear sites.   • UN says Afghan arrests in Pakistan spike by 146pc in one week
    Dawn - 03:15 Nov 08, 2025
    ISLAMABAD: The number of Afghan nationals arrested and detained in Pakistan surged by 146 per cent in a single week, a spike linked to the reopening of border crossings, according to a joint report by the UN Refugee Agency (UNHCR) and the International Organisation for Migration (IOM). A total of 7,764 Afghan nationals were arrested and detained in the week ending Nov 1, a significant increase from the previous week, the report said. Of those arrested between Oct 26 and Nov 1, Afghan Citizen Card (ACC) holders and undocumented Afghans accounted for 77pc, while Proof of Registration (PoR) card holders represented the remaining 23 pc, it added. The report noted that 86pc of the arrests and detentions occurred in Balochistan. Across the country, the top three districts for arrests and detentions between Jan 1 and Nov 1, 2025, were Chagi, Attock and Quetta.   • Pakistan faces climate fragility, warn lenders
    Dawn - 02:32 Nov 08, 2025
    ISLAMABAD: The International Financial Institutions (IFIs) have raised urgent concerns over Pakistan’s escalating climate vulnerability and environmental degradation, warning that unchecked population growth and dwindling natural resources could deepen the country’s fragility. These observations and recommendations emerged during the closing plenary of the 28th Sustainable Development Conference held on Friday, where experts — including representatives from the World Bank and the International Monetary Fund (IMF) — underscored the need for immediate action. World Bank Country Director Dr Bolormaa Amgabazar said that Pakistan faces alarmingly high vulnerability to climate change and natural disasters, compounded by escalating air and water pollution. At the same time, the country’s rapid population growth — among the highest globally — is placing immense strain on its already depleting natural resources, posing serious long-term risks to environmental and economic stability.   • Govt posts rare Rs2.12tr surplus in first quarter
    Dawn - 02:22 Nov 08, 2025
    ISLAMABAD: Backed by record interest income of the State Bank of Pakistan (SBP), a 30 per cent surge in petroleum levy collection and strong provincial cash surpluses, the government on Friday reported one of its rare fiscal surpluses — at 1.6pc of GDP — in the first quarter of the current fiscal year, slightly below last year’s 1.7pc. According to the Ministry of Finance’s fiscal operations report for July-September 2025, the overall budget balance showed a surplus of Rs2.12 trillion in absolute terms, up 10pc from Rs1.896tr in the same period last year. As a share of GDP, the surplus slipped marginally from 1.7pc to 1.6pc. Last year eventually closed with a 5.4pc deficit, as rising expenditures gradually offset the one-time impact of SBP profits. The primary balance — the difference between total revenue and expenditure, excluding interest payments — stood at 2.7pc of GDP this year, slightly lower than last year’s 2.8pc.
